The median sale price of a home in Woodberry was $435K last month, up 6.1% since last year. The median sale price per square foot in Woodberry is $167, down 3.5% since last year.
What is the housing market like in Woodberry today?
In March 2024, Woodberry home prices were up 6.1% compared to last year, selling for a median price of $435K.

Overall, Woodberry has a minimal risk of flooding impacting the community over the next 30 years.

Woodberry has a minor risk of wildfire. There are 157 properties in Woodberry that have some risk of being affected by wildfire over the next 30 years. This represents 100% of all properties in Woodberry.

Woodberry has a Major Wind Factor® risk based on the projected likelihood and speed of hurricane, tornado, or severe storm winds impacting it. Woodberry is most at risk from hurricanes. 97 properties in Woodberry have some risk of being in a severe wind event within the next 30 years.
